We signed up for a "vacation plan" for $7,500.00. We were not asked how much we wanted to put down. The just took out $7,596.00. We signed it and went home. We thought it was a great idea, but came home and checked it out on the web. They have so many complaints and everyone is calling it a scam. They can never get these people on the phone to plan their vacation. They offer weeks for $500.00 per week. We read the brochures when we got home and it said "from" 499...

There on the contract it stated no cancellations and this document is legal and binding. How can we get our money back? We were scammed. We are idiots. Aren't contracts suppose to have a cancellation period? We need help to fight this.

We purchase a membership Sept. 17, 2007. Have tried to use our membership without success. Finally after months of trying, filed a complaint with Department of Consumer Advocate South Carolina, a TV station in SC, and several internet complaint boards. Here is part of their response to all three areas:They said:

'they had explained, and stated at the seminar where we bought the membership, and in their membership pack, any request for accommodation outside their 'major areas of concentration', was not promised their service.

Well, I am printing, directly from their membership packet:

'The VIP Travel Plan is unique in the fact that 'each' time you travel you will enjoy substantial savings. Whether you enjoy luxurious condos, cruising, all-inclusive reports, 3, 4, and 5 Star hotels, discounts on theme park tickets, restaurants, golf or RV rental, we can accommodate 'all' of your travel needs while saving you and your family money.'

(1) That's what we were told at the seminar, when we bought the membership;
(2) that is what is published in their membership pack.

It appears they do not abide by their own membership publications. I have not attaacked them anywhere. I have, however, stated fact, after fact, after fact.

Please review here and other internet complaint boards, do a search on
'VIP Travel' and you can decide for yourself if you wish to do business with them.
49 days ago by Rick Butler [send email]
VIP Travel was sued by South Carolina Department of Consumer Advocate in April 2008. Most say something about VIP Travel.
